About the role

We are currently recruiting for a Business Admin Support to join QinetiQ Target Systems (QTS) within our Administration Team. QTS is a wholly owned subsidiary of QinetiQ Group PLC, specialising in the design and manufacture of a range of state-of-the-art Unmanned Aerial and Surface Target systems, including the world-leading Banshee target.

QTS targets are used to enable realistic weapons test and evaluation and operator training in over 40 countries worldwide, with QTS providing a complete managed service in over 15 of these countries.

What will I be doing?

Reporting to the HR Manager, you will provide an efficient and friendly reception and administration service for QTS UK.

Hours and the pattern in which they are worked is negotiable.

Duties will include:
Manage the day-to-day operations of the reception area and switchboard, including welcoming visitors and transferring incoming calls quickly and efficiently.
Manage the shared email inbox and associated requests.
Arranging travel for staff as required, including hotel bookings, car hire, flights, ferries, Eurostar, Chauffeurs, and obtaining any other travel information required.
Record and maintain biodata records for staff who travel of business in line with GDPR guidelines.
Booking conference rooms and arranging refreshments for training and meetings as appropriate.
Booking and recording of employee training, as directed by the HR Manager.
Buying and maintaining of stock for meeting rooms and canteen supplies.
Maintaining the Conference and Board rooms to a clean and tidy appearance, ensuring they are well stocked.
Regular cleaning and upkeep of coffee machines, arranging servicing and call outs when required.
Arranging eye tests for employees as required and issuing associated vouchers. Keeping records of vouchers issued and eye tests attended.
Carry out any other administration tasks, as directed by the HR Manager as required including (but not limited to) ordering business cards, drafting letters, collating information for flu vaccine vouchers and assisting with occupational health related site visits.

What do I need?

You will have proven experience in a receptionist / administration role and have good customer service skills.

You’ll be proficient in the Microsoft Office packages and have excellent attention to detail. Knowledge of booking travel would be a distinct advantage.

We also ask that you:
are qualified to GCSE or equivalent level in maths and English
have excellent verbal and written communication skills, enabling effective interaction with internal staff, visitors, customers and suppliers
have excellent organisational skills with the ability to prioritise tasks to meet deadlines
are a team player
are self-motivated and able to work without close supervision
have the ability to work in a busy and sometimes pressurised environment
